Before you start planning next year in detail, setting goals (you do set goals don't you) and making your new year's resolutions (business and personal) it is worth looking back on 2007.
While Peter suggests 24 questions I'll let you come up with your own beyond these few:
- Has the year gone as well as you hoped?
- What have you learnt this year?
- Is there anything that you didn't do that you wish you did?
- Is there anything that you did do that you regret?
- What will you do differently next year?
I'll also refer you back to that great Brian Tracy question in Difficult Decisions Made Easier:
"Knowing what I know now, would I still make the same decision?"
